feat: update fixing error build
This commit is contained in:
parent
608afb32c2
commit
8d7f90a48f
|
|
@ -1,3 +0,0 @@
|
||||||
{
|
|
||||||
"extends": "next/core-web-vitals"
|
|
||||||
}
|
|
||||||
|
|
@ -50,24 +50,22 @@ const KnowledgeBase = () => {
|
||||||
<TabsList className="md:flex-col gap-2 flex-wrap md:items-start justify-start">
|
<TabsList className="md:flex-col gap-2 flex-wrap md:items-start justify-start">
|
||||||
<CreateCategory onSuccess={fetchCategoryList} />
|
<CreateCategory onSuccess={fetchCategoryList} />
|
||||||
{categories?.map((category: any, index: number) => (
|
{categories?.map((category: any, index: number) => (
|
||||||
<div>
|
<TabsTrigger
|
||||||
<TabsTrigger
|
key={index}
|
||||||
key={index}
|
value={`category-${index}`}
|
||||||
value={`category-${index}`}
|
onClick={() => {
|
||||||
onClick={() => {
|
fetchQuestions(category?.id);
|
||||||
fetchQuestions(category?.id);
|
}}
|
||||||
}}
|
className="data-[state=active]:bg-secondary data-[state=active]:text-default rounded-md px-6 py-3 w-full justify-start"
|
||||||
className="data-[state=active]:bg-secondary data-[state=active]:text-default rounded-md px-6 py-3 w-full justify-start"
|
>
|
||||||
|
{category?.name}
|
||||||
|
<div
|
||||||
|
className="absolute right-2 top-2 hidden group-hover:inline-flex"
|
||||||
|
// onClick={() => deleteCategory(category?.id)}
|
||||||
>
|
>
|
||||||
{category?.name}
|
<Trash2 className="w-3.5 h-3.5 me-1" />
|
||||||
<div
|
</div>
|
||||||
className="absolute right-2 top-2 hidden group-hover:inline-flex"
|
</TabsTrigger>
|
||||||
// onClick={() => deleteCategory(category?.id)}
|
|
||||||
>
|
|
||||||
<Trash2 className="w-3.5 h-3.5 me-1" />
|
|
||||||
</div>
|
|
||||||
</TabsTrigger>
|
|
||||||
</div>
|
|
||||||
))}
|
))}
|
||||||
</TabsList>
|
</TabsList>
|
||||||
</CardContent>
|
</CardContent>
|
||||||
|
|
|
||||||
|
|
@ -19,7 +19,7 @@ const dummyContent = [
|
||||||
{ title: "Operasi Zebra Nataru", thumbnail: "/assets/hot-topik-1.jpg", createdAt: "17 Agustus 2025", timezone: "14:20 WIB", clickCount: "28" },
|
{ title: "Operasi Zebra Nataru", thumbnail: "/assets/hot-topik-1.jpg", createdAt: "17 Agustus 2025", timezone: "14:20 WIB", clickCount: "28" },
|
||||||
];
|
];
|
||||||
|
|
||||||
const ContentManagement = (props: { type: string }) => {
|
const ContentManagement = () => {
|
||||||
const [profile, setProfile] = useState<any>();
|
const [profile, setProfile] = useState<any>();
|
||||||
const [province, setProvince] = useState([]);
|
const [province, setProvince] = useState([]);
|
||||||
const [, setUser] = useState();
|
const [, setUser] = useState();
|
||||||
|
|
|
||||||
|
|
@ -564,7 +564,7 @@ export default function FormImageAI() {
|
||||||
JIka Anda tidak Memberikan kata kunci, kami akan secara
|
JIka Anda tidak Memberikan kata kunci, kami akan secara
|
||||||
otomatis membuat kata kunci yang relevan dari kata kunci utama
|
otomatis membuat kata kunci yang relevan dari kata kunci utama
|
||||||
untuk setiap bagian dan menggunakannya untuk membuat artikel.
|
untuk setiap bagian dan menggunakannya untuk membuat artikel.
|
||||||
Untuk menambahkan kata kunci baru, ketik ', + kata kunci'.
|
Untuk menambahkan kata kunci baru, ketik ', + kata kunci'.
|
||||||
</p>
|
</p>
|
||||||
<div className="mt-3">
|
<div className="mt-3">
|
||||||
<Textarea
|
<Textarea
|
||||||
|
|
|
||||||
|
|
@ -585,8 +585,8 @@ export default function FormImage() {
|
||||||
JIka Anda tidak Memberikan kata kunci, kami akan secara
|
JIka Anda tidak Memberikan kata kunci, kami akan secara
|
||||||
otomatis membuat kata kunci yang relevan dari kata kunci
|
otomatis membuat kata kunci yang relevan dari kata kunci
|
||||||
utama untuk setiap bagian dan menggunakannya untuk membuat
|
utama untuk setiap bagian dan menggunakannya untuk membuat
|
||||||
artikel. Untuk menambahkan kata kunci baru, ketik ', +
|
artikel. Untuk menambahkan kata kunci baru, ketik ', +
|
||||||
kata kunci'.
|
kata kunci'.
|
||||||
</p>
|
</p>
|
||||||
<div className="mt-3">
|
<div className="mt-3">
|
||||||
<Textarea
|
<Textarea
|
||||||
|
|
|
||||||
|
|
@ -45,7 +45,6 @@ export type Notification = {
|
||||||
};
|
};
|
||||||
|
|
||||||
const getNotificationIcon = (notificationTypeId: number) => {
|
const getNotificationIcon = (notificationTypeId: number) => {
|
||||||
const router = useRouter();
|
|
||||||
switch (notificationTypeId) {
|
switch (notificationTypeId) {
|
||||||
case 2:
|
case 2:
|
||||||
return <MessageCircle className="h-8 w-8 text-success" />;
|
return <MessageCircle className="h-8 w-8 text-success" />;
|
||||||
|
|
|
||||||
|
|
@ -0,0 +1,13 @@
|
||||||
|
import { FlatCompat } from '@eslint/eslintrc'
|
||||||
|
|
||||||
|
const compat = new FlatCompat({
|
||||||
|
baseDirectory: import.meta.dirname,
|
||||||
|
})
|
||||||
|
|
||||||
|
const eslintConfig = [
|
||||||
|
...compat.config({
|
||||||
|
extends: ['next/core-web-vitals', 'next/typescript'],
|
||||||
|
}),
|
||||||
|
]
|
||||||
|
|
||||||
|
export default eslintConfig
|
||||||
|
|
@ -45,6 +45,11 @@ const nextConfig = {
|
||||||
},
|
},
|
||||||
],
|
],
|
||||||
},
|
},
|
||||||
|
// eslint: {
|
||||||
|
// // Warning: This allows production builds to successfully complete even if
|
||||||
|
// // your project has ESLint errors.
|
||||||
|
// ignoreDuringBuilds: true,
|
||||||
|
// },
|
||||||
};
|
};
|
||||||
|
|
||||||
export default bundleAnalyzer(withNextIntl(withNextra(nextConfig)));
|
export default bundleAnalyzer(withNextIntl(withNextra(nextConfig)));
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ue